We did make it through our day of learning. We reviewed our oral vocabulary words learned yesterday and learned three new words today (companion, groom, popular). We then worked on visualization as we read about different pets. Next, we used our letter folders to spell and read words with l-blends. Following that, we learned to make most words plural we add an -s. We practiced spelling and reading -s plural words. We ended our morning by using our sight words in sentences.
This afternoon in Language Arts, we reread A Pig for Cliff. We then wrote about what makes the story a fantasy and about the characters, setting, and events in the story. We ended our day by color coding sentences based on whether they were a statement or a question.
